How to create the Tulip Tote Card:
Create the Card Base:
Trim a panel of Breeze cardstock to 4-1/4″ x 5-1/2″ and emboss it with the Market Crates embossing folder. Adhere it to the front of a top-folding A2-sized white card base.
Build the Tote:
Next, cut a 2″ x 4-1/4″ panel of Waterfall cardstock and emboss it with the Market Weave embossing Folder. Cut the handle and top trim from Teal Topaz cardstock, and the handle reinforcements from gold cardstock. Set aside.
Add the Tulips:
Die cut all the tulips and leaves, assemble them, and arrange them on the card front until you’re happy with the placement.
Attach the Tote:
Add a generous amount of white glue to the back of the back (avoiding the handle), and adhere it to the bottom of the card. This will secure all the flower stems neatly in place.
Finish the Card:
Stamp the sentiment into a scrap of Waterfall cardstock, die cut it with the coordinating die and adhere it in to the center of the tote.
